    Thumbs up VX Search

    You could do worse than to try Carmax.com I found three in the southeast, although none in Atlanta.

    Only a week into it, I went with one that stayed on the market for over a month at their Greeneville, SC location. They have a no-haggle price policy. I got my 2000 Ebony Black VX with 32k miles for under $18k. My credit union even explained that the loan value was well-over $20k and indicated that it I was buying at a decent price. Whatever the case, it's affordable and fits me like a glove! I've already run out of folks to show-it-off to, so looks like I need more friends

    Coming from central GA, if they have one at a distant location, you can arrange to have one shipped for around $150. This is deducted from the purchase price if you decide to go through with the sale.

    I was a little apprehensive about paying for a test-drive of something so different, so I made the 2-hour haul to South Carolina. So far, I'm glad I did. And I put the $150 clams toward the purchase of a "hat for the lady" (Load-Warrior).
